Re: Cricket at Old Trafford
I don't know if you watch much live cricket but the action is far quicker from the side to the point you might struggle seeing the ball whizz past.
Always best to get seats behind the bowlers arm on a 2nd tier if you can.

Re: Cricket at Old Trafford
Stand A is the best for the sun, and you're at a 45 degree angle to the wicket. Closer to the bars too.
Oh and much more legroom than the double tiered stands.
